# Coordiante systems are stored as Fields
|
||||
|
||||
Previously, `DataSet` managed `CoordinateSystem`s separately from `Field`s.
|
||||
However, a `CoordinateSystem` is really just a `Field` with some special
|
||||
attributes. Thus, coordiante systems are now just listed along with the
|
||||
rest of the fields, and the coordinate systems are simply strings that
|
||||
point back to the appropriate field. (This was actually the original
|
||||
concept for `DataSet`, but the coordinate systems were separated from
|
||||
fields for some now obsolete reasons.)
|
||||
|
||||
This change should not be very noticible, but there are a few consequences
|
||||
that should be noted.
|
||||
|
||||
1. The `GetCoordinateSystem` methods no longer return a reference to a
|
||||
`CoordinateSystem` object. This is because the `CoordinateSystem` object
|
||||
is made on the fly from the field.
|
||||
2. When mapping fields in filters, the coordinate systems get mapped as
|
||||
part of this process. This has allowed us to remove some of the special
|
||||
cases needed to set the coordinate system in the output.
|
||||
3. If a filter is generating a coordinate system in a special way
|
||||
(different than mapping other point fields), then it can use the special
|
||||
`CreateResultCoordianteSystem` method to attach this custom coordinate
|
||||
system to the output.
|
||||
4. The `DataSet::GetCoordianteSystems()` method to get a `vector<>` of all
|
||||
coordiante systems is removed. `DataSet` no longer internally has this
|
||||
structure. Although it could be built, the only reason for its existance
|
||||
was to support passing coordinate systems in filters. Now that this is
|
||||
done autmoatically, the method is no longer needed.

/// \brief Specify whether to always pass coordinate systems.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// `CoordinateSystem`s in a `DataSet` are really just point fields marked as being a
|
||||
/// coordinate system. Thus, a coordinate system is passed if and only if the associated
|
||||
/// field is passed.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// By default, the filter will pass all fields associated with a coordinate system
|
||||
/// regardless of the `FieldsToPass` marks the field as passing. If this option is set
|
||||
/// to `false`, then coordinate systems will only be passed if it is marked so by
|
||||
/// `FieldsToPass`.
